A sharp and insightful view of the Gaza conflict
Award-winning and translated writer García Ortega blends travel diaries, personal reflections, analyses, and interviews with both Israelis and Palestinians to offer a profound exploration of the ongoing war and political landscape.
This book, far from being complacent with the official narrative of the Israeli-Palestinian conflict, masterfully integrates narrative journalism with academic rigor. It provides a nuanced perspective that transcends simplistic labels of anti-Israel or pro-Palestine. García Ortega delivers a balanced critique, acknowledging Israel's responsibility for the current crisis — the unprecedented cruelty against Gaza, the political failings of the Netanyahu government, and the need for its removal from power. At the same time, the author examines Hamas’ provocative strategy.
Above all, Another Possible Israel emphasizes the urgent need for fundamental policy changes from both Israel and Palestine to achieve a definitive resolution, proposing a two-state solution while recognizing the significant challenges involved.
A timely and necessary book from one of Spain’s leading intellectuals that provides a clearheaded, fresh perspective on a problem that remains unresolved after more than 70 years.
